The increasing complexity of digital systems has led to a growing need for efficient design and analysis methodologies. One popular approach is to use Hardware Description Languages (HDLs) such as VHDL (VHSIC-HDL). VHDL allows designers to model and analyze digital systems at various levels of abstraction, making it an essential tool for digital system design.
